The Heart Sutra.

This much loved Buddhist teaching is a reminder of the nature of things, a stand-alone sutra of immense beauty and a doorway into the transcendental.

In this talk, Caitlin will give a very light introduction to the Heart Sutra, and use that as a basis for a discussion of emptiness as an inherently compassionate, connecting teaching.
This will open up the space for the group to explore how this teaching is still relevant in today’s world.

Wellington Young Buddhists are a group of young people (18-35) that meet on a Wednesday evening to explore a topic on ‘Buddhism and everyday life’. Our group is aimed at young people and our unique experiences; be that dealing with difficult emotions, social media, new relationships, or addictive behaviours. We strive to hold a space for openness and manaaki.

Our discussions are self-directed, but guided by experienced Buddhist practitioners, who provide food for thought such as specific teachings or practices to take home.

We end with a short, guided meditation which connects to the topic discussed.

Folks of all backgrounds, cultures, and traditions are welcome.
